Bitcoin Surpasses $72K Amidst Sustained ETF Inflows

Bitcoin has breached the $72,000 mark, reaching a new price milestone. This surge comes as U.S. spot Bitcoin exchange-traded funds (ETFs) experienced another day of net inflows, adding $155 million on Wednesday.

This inflow marks the fourteenth consecutive trading day that these institutional investment vehicles have seen net positive capital, indicating sustained interest from a segment of the market.

Despite the persistent inflows and the upward price momentum, on-chain analytics firm Glassnode has cautioned that underlying demand for Bitcoin may remain fragile. This suggests a potential divergence between ETF-driven capital flows and broader retail or organic demand.

The continued inflow into Bitcoin ETFs highlights the growing accessibility of the cryptocurrency for institutional investors through regulated products. This trend is a significant indicator of evolving financial market participation in digital assets.
